History of the conference
In 1998 number theorists at Laval University and the University of Maine
founded the Maine/Québec Conference on Number
Theory and Related Topics.
Since then it has been held annually on a weekend in early Fall
(except 2001, when the conference was cancelled
due to the attack on the world trade center).
We invite number theorists and mathematicians in related areas
from New England, eastern Canada, and beyond
to speak about their research and discuss ideas for future work.
Each year there is a change in venue: odd years at UMaine, even years at
ULaval. This Fall it was held on September 29th and 30th in Orono, ME.
The conference started on the morning of Saturday Sept. 29
and end Sunday afternoon.
